201945, ATHENIAN, Cleveland (OH), Museum of Art, Cleveland (OH), Museum of Art, Switzerland, private, Rome, market, 74.10

  • Vase Number: 201945
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: BLACK-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: AMPHORA, NECK
  • Date: -550 to -500
  • Inscriptions: NIKOSTHENES
    Signature: NIKOSTHENESEPOIESEN
  • Attributed To: N P by BEAZLEY
    NIKOSTHENES by SIGNATURE
    THIASOS GROUP by BEAZLEY
  • Decoration: A,B: SATYRS, MAENADS, SOME IN NEBRIDES
    Neck A and B: KOMOS, YOUTHS, KRATER
    Shoulder A and B: SPHINX BETWEEN LIONS
  • Current Collection: Cleveland (OH), Museum of Art: 1974.10

  • CAVI Collection: Cleveland 74.10.
  • CAVI Lemma: BF Nikosthenic neck amphora. Painter N. Nikosthenes, potter. 530-520.
  • CAVI Subject: Neck: komos: A, B, each: two naked youths; on A, a handleless krater between them. Shoulder: A, B, each: sphinx between lions. Body: A, B, each: satyrs and maenads. On the preserved handle: floral.
  • CAVI Inscriptions: Under the preserved handle (the right handle seen from A): Nικοσθενες εποιεσεν.
  • CAVI Comments: Ex Roman Market. Ex Bellinzona, Private. Ex Swiss Private.
